Customer Service Representative Intern P&H Milling P&H is the largest Canadian-owned milling company.

The P&H Milling Group sources wheat from Western Canada, Ontario, and Atlantic Canada to produce quality flour and cereal products.

The lineup includes hard red spring wheat flour for breads and other bakery products, soft winter wheat flour for cakes and cookies, and semolina flour for pasta, organic flour, and atta flour for chapati.

In our specialty milling operation in Saskatoon, we also mill pea fractions.

  • From its mills in Halifax, Nova Scotia; Acton, Hanover, Hamilton and Cambridge, Ontario; Saskatoon, Saskatchewan; and Lethbridge, Alberta, the P&H Milling Group supplies flour to customers throughout Canada, the United States, the Caribbean, the Middle East, Iceland, and Pacific Rim countries.

P&H’s roots go back over 115 years.

We have always been a Canadian, family-owned, and managed agri-business that understands the qualities and conditions needed for meaningful growth.

Our corporate culture values are family values; honesty and integrity with a focus on listening and continuous learning.

Like family, we support our staff to always do better.

With over 80 locations spanning from coast to coast, and trade links around the globe, P&H is growth-oriented, diversified and vertically integrated with operations spanning across grain merchandising, flour milling, crop input distribution and animal feed production.
